About The AES Corporation

The AES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a power generation and utility company. It operates through four segments: Renewables, Utilities, Energy Infrastructure, and New Energy Technologies. The company owns and/or operates power plants to generate and sell power to…

Source: Yahoo Finance

Sector & Industry

The AES Corporation operates in the Utilities sector, within the Utilities - Diversified industry group. It is listed on the NYSE exchange.
